After leading the Veterans Day ceremony in Cedarhurst in his position as commander of the Lawrence Cedarhurst American Legion Post 339, Syd Mandelbaum received the honor of being inducted in the New York State Veterans Hall of Fame through a nomination from State Assemblywoman Melissa Miller (R-Atlantic Beach).

Mandelbaum, a Cedarhurst resident, is founder and chief executive officer of Rock and Wrap It Up! an anti-poverty think tank that recently established a Feed the Veterans program. Mandelbaum served stateside in the Air Force Reserves from 1969-’75.

Also inducted were Luke Magliaro, also of Cedarhurst, and Inwood resident Frank Santora.

The virtual Hall of Fame was established to recognize veterans from New York who have distinguished themselves in the military and civilian life.
